Dye your hair the day before you leave

Everything is ready for departure. Suitcase, beauty case, mattress, rubber bands … Oh no hair! You forgot to paint and can’t imagine leaving without giving a touch of color and vitality to your hair. What to do then? Opt for DIY or call your trusted hair stylist right away for a flash color? Unfortunately neither.

Dyeing your hair the day before you leave for the holidays very wrong. And that’s because, assuming you don’t go to a cave but have opted for a nice warm and sunny post, your hair dyed they should not be exposed to the sun for at least 48 hours or more by coloring. The reason? The hair must have time to oxygenate and “recover” from the color, preventing the hair from being damaged.

That’s why it’s always good program the tint first with your trusted hair stylist, who will be able to give you the right information on timing and color.

Choosing the “wrong” color

Another mistake to avoid when choosing to dye your hair in the summer (but not only) is that of indulge in the desire for change and color, opting for colors that are perhaps a little too daring. Given that any color if you like it and make you feel good is welcome, it is important to know that, especially in summer, radically change your look it might not be a good idea.

The sun (but also salt, sand, chlorine, etc.), in fact, tends to naturally lighten the hair, even those dyed. For this reason, in order not to risk losing the shade of color you so desired after only two days at sea, it is good postpone your change of look to September. Or in any case after the holidays, avoiding to find yourself with one faded and ruined hair.

Dye your hair with too dark colors

In addition to the more accentuated colors such as pink, blue, green, red, purple, etc., which, as mentioned, it would be better to postpone to autumn, they should also avoided too dark colors. Or better. There is no point in opting for a darker tint just to try to stem the inevitable lightening of the hair with the sun.

Much better, however, to consult with your hairdresser and direct you towards an increase in the pigmentation of the chosen color, intensifying the tint with more color. In this way, even if you lighten up, you will not lose much of the original tone chosen. Avoiding having to wear hair that does not fully satisfy the look you dreamed of.

Forget about protection

Finally, a very common mistake that we all make with our hair is that of not protect them adequately. If the sun and all other external agents can damage your hair even without having undergone treatment, think about what can happen if your hair is even more delicate after dyeing.

For this it is important to always protect the foliage with a few but fundamental measures such as:

  • apply a oil or serum protective before exposure to the sun (and after each bath);
  • wet your hair before entering the water, so that they absorb fresh water avoiding being damaged by salt or chlorine;
  • use a wide head hat, which in addition to protecting the hair will also shield your face from the harmful effect of the sun’s rays;
  • use only specific products for colored hair;
  • avoid stressing the hair with the heat of plates and phones, opting instead for spontaneous beach waves or a totally natural look.
